Trivia about the song Black And White by Static-X

When was the song “Black And White” released by Static-X?
The song Black And White was released in 2001, on the album “Machine”.
Who composed the song “Black And White” by Static-X?
The song “Black And White” by Static-X was composed by Ken Jay and Wayne Static.
